Antique Floral Wool Hand Knotted Pile Brown Earth Tone 1920s Rug, Circa Date: 1920s. This exquisite piece captures the refined aesthetic of the early 20th century. Its primary palette features a rich, dusty rose field framed by a muted khaki border, establishing a sophisticated foundation characteristic of brown earth tone color rugs.
The design is characterized by its intentional negative space, allowing the soft field color to dominate. Scattered, stylized floral sprays—rendered in vibrant accents of cobalt blue, cream, and ochre—float elegantly across the composition. This restrained use of floral rugs motifs is a hallmark of the period’s departure from dense, traditional designs.
Hand-knotted from fine wool, the pile retains a luxurious, soft texture indicative of high-quality workshop production.
